CVE-2023-30591

7.5 · HIGH
Published Sep 29, 2023 nodebb CWE-241 EPSS 53.80% (99th pctl)

Overview

CVE-2023-30591 is a high-severity vulnerability affecting nodebb nodebb. It was published on September 29, 2023 and has a CVSS 3.1 base score of 7.5 (HIGH).

This vulnerability has a CVSS 3.1 base score of 7.5, rated HIGH. It can be exploited remotely over the network. No authentication or special privileges are required for exploitation.

Technical Description

Denial-of-service in NodeBB <= v2.8.10 allows unauthenticated attackers to trigger a crash, when invoking `eventName.startsWith()` or `eventName.toString()`, while processing Socket.IO messages via crafted Socket.IO messages containing array or object type for the event name respectively.
